How to Play

The objective is to guide the hero safely to the princess by removing pins in the correct order. Examine each level carefully to identify which pins block the path or trigger helpful actions. Pulling a pin might drop a bridge, remove a barrier, or release a helpful item. One wrong move can block progress, so think before acting. The game encourages trying different approaches and learning from mistakes. As you advance, new elements like moving obstacles or timed challenges appear, keeping the gameplay fresh. Collect hidden treasures along the way for bonus points and extra fun.
